Dehydrated citrus pulp and citrus pulp-protein supplements were evaluated as potential supplements for a preconditioning program. The supplements compared were no supplement, citrus pulp alone, citrus pulp with urea, and citrus pulp with added UIP. Supplemented cattle produced greater gains than unsupplemented cattle. Protein-calorie malnutrition is a transversal condition to all stages of chronic liver disease. Early recognition of micro or macronutrient deficiencies is essential, because the use of nutritional supplements reduces the risk of complications.
